During post-production the film received a great deal of media attention when, in response to Moby distancing himself from the movie and Moby’s management’s statement to TIME Magazine that he “no longer agrees with the film creatively”, director Paul Yates sold Moby’s soul on eBay
EBay
eBay Inc. is an American internet consumer-to-consumer corporation that manages eBay.com, an online auction and shopping website in which people and businesses buy and sell a broad variety of goods and services worldwide...

. They have since put their differences behind them.
